    Antiplane Earthquake Waves in Long Structures

    Source: Journal of Engineering Mechanics:;1989:;Volume ( 115 ):;issue: 012
    Author:
    M. I. Todorovska
    ,
    M. D. Trifunac
    DOI: 10.1061/(ASCE)0733-9399(1989)115:12(2687)
    Publisher: American Society of Civil Engineers
    Abstract: In this paper, the physical phenomena associated with wave passage under long buildings have been studied. A two‐dimensional, continuous model has been used to represent the building vibration. Analytical, closed‐form solutions have been obtained for the response to incident monochromatic, plane
